Daniel's point is well taken, as who is to say when a question has been fully answered. I agree that my response was flawed.

Two suggestions: if a thread starts to veer, no reason why the next poster can't go back to the original point and get things back in order.

Second, I think part of Leon's job as moderator is exactly what the title suggests: to moderate the forum. If he sees we have digressed too far, he can request we get back to the issues. It doesn't entail locking or deleting.

As a sidenote, one topic that seems to be incredibly popular on this board is Seinfeld. I bring this up because while it has absolutely nothing to do with vintage cards, many of us genuinely have fun with it. So my question is when is it acceptable to talk about it, and at what point does it go too far? Or is it just better to say Seinfeld discussion is banned (please don't go that far )
